April 21, 2005 -- CoActiv Medical Business Solutions of Ridgefield, CT, a software and systems provider to hospitals and imaging centers, today announced that Medical Imaging Center, P.C. in Bloomfield, CT, selected CoActiv's digital archive and storage solution, EXAM-Vault, which is part of CoActiv's picture archiving and communications system, EXAM-PACS. Medical Imaging Center of Bloomfield, one of the first imaging centers to perform digital mammography in Connecticut, will use the modular CoActiv EXAM-Vault to store and archive digital mammography, ultrasound, CT, nuclear medicine and other exams to securely manage patient radiological images and records throughout the enterprise.
Medical Imaging Center of Bloomfield provides radiology services to the communities surrounding Hartford, CT, and is part of an imaging enterprise network consisting of seven locations. CoActiv has provided digital imaging and IT support to the Bloomfield and Rocky Hill locations for almost two years. CoActiv was able to integrate the CoActiv EXAM-Vault archive and storage solution with Bloomfield's existing digital modalities without any downtime or workflow disruptions. Existing exams from all modalities and new exams were transferred to CoActiv's EXAM-Vault, which automatically and securely archives exams using a unique "Quad-redundant" storage technique that saves every exam in four locations, three of which are on-line and instantly accessible. CoActiv EXAM-Vault stores exams on-line at the local facility and also archives the exams on-line at off-site multiple redundant class A data-centers, as well as on redundant removable media. As soon as an exam is received from any DICOM compliant modality, it is first stored on the local EXAM-Server, and then the exam is instantly, and automatically, sent to a primary data-center archive. Once at the primary datacenter, the exam is then simultaneously mirrored to a redundant on-line archive site. Exams in both sites reside on huge multi-terabyte disk drive RAID arrays with hot spare redundant drives, redundant power supplies, redundant cooling fans and high-speed SCSI data transfer facilities. These arrays are outfitted with automatic remote monitoring, as well as local technical staff monitoring. And finally, all exams are permanently archived to duplicate digital removable media, with one copy stored in a secure vault and the other forwarded to the client site.

CoActiv also provides Bloomfield with a CD burning solution, CoActiv EXAM-Filer, which creates self-contained, study CDs accessible from any CD or DVD equipped Windows PC. The EXAM-Filer can receive directly from multiple DICOM modalities, has robotic capabilities and each exam-CD prominently highlights the imaging facility's name, logo, address, phone, website address etc., for identification and marketing purposes.
About CoActiv
CoActiv Medical Business Solutions, a healthcare digital imaging solution provider headquartered in Ridgefield, CT, provides a complete line of PACS, tele-radiology and DICOM utilities and services. Through their EXAM-PACS solution, CoActiv provides an affordable but powerful PACS, easily scalable from small single sites to enterprise installations. CoActiv has received FDA 510(k) clearance to market EXAM-PACS to the medical field and has recently become one of the first PACS providers to receive FDA clearance for Primary Digital Mammography PACS reading. CoActiv, founded in 2002 by the management of its parent company, AMSYS Inc., is backed by nearly twenty years of broad corporate experience in healthcare IT solutions.
